Why Use Vinegar?

Vinegar is an excellent cleaning agent for several reasons. Firstly, it’s a natural product, which means it’s safe for you, your family, and the environment. Unlike many commercial cleaners, vinegar doesn’t contain harsh chemicals that can harm your skin or respiratory system.

Secondly, vinegar is highly acidic, which makes it effective at breaking down tough stains and killing bacteria. This acidity is especially useful for cleaning toilet bowls, where stains and bacteria can build up over time.

Finally, vinegar is cheap and readily available. You probably already have a bottle in your kitchen, making it a convenient option for cleaning your toilet bowl.

What You’ll Need

Before you start cleaning your toilet bowl with vinegar, you’ll need to gather a few supplies.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• A bottle of white vinegar
  • A toilet brush
  • Gloves
  • Baking soda (optional)

White vinegar is the best type to use for cleaning purposes. It’s clear, so it won’t stain your toilet bowl, and it’s highly acidic, which makes it effective at breaking down stains and killing bacteria. A toilet brush is essential for scrubbing the bowl, and gloves will protect your hands from the vinegar and any bacteria in the toilet.

Baking soda is optional, but it can be useful for tackling particularly tough stains. When combined with vinegar, it creates a fizzing reaction that can help to lift stains from the surface of the toilet bowl.

How to Clean Your Toilet Bowl with Vinegar

Now that you’ve gathered your supplies, it’s time to start cleaning.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to clean your toilet bowl with vinegar:

  1. Put on your gloves.
  2. Flush the toilet to wet the sides of the bowl.
  3. Pour a cup of vinegar into the toilet bowl, making sure to cover all sides.
  4. Let the vinegar sit for at least 10 minutes to allow it to break down stains and kill bacteria.
  5. Use the toilet brush to scrub the bowl, paying special attention to any stained areas.
  6. Flush the toilet to rinse away the vinegar and loosened stains.

If you’re dealing with a particularly tough stain, you might want to use the vinegar and baking soda method. Here’s how:

  1. Follow steps 1-3 as above.
  2. Sprinkle a cup of baking soda into the toilet bowl.
  3. Pour another cup of vinegar into the bowl. The vinegar and baking soda will react, causing a fizzing action that can help to lift stains.
  4. Let the mixture sit for at least 15 minutes.
  5. Scrub the bowl with the toilet brush, then flush the toilet to rinse away the mixture and loosened stains.

Maintaining a Clean Toilet Bowl

Regular cleaning is the key to maintaining a clean toilet bowl. By cleaning your toilet bowl with vinegar once a week, you can prevent stains and bacteria from building up. This will not only keep your toilet looking clean, but it will also help to keep it smelling fresh.

If you notice a stain starting to form, don’t wait until your next scheduled cleaning to tackle it. The sooner you clean a stain, the easier it will be to remove. Simply follow the cleaning steps outlined above to keep your toilet bowl in top shape.
